Inclusivity Statement

As we grow into our understanding of what it means to be made in the image of God, we invite you to come be who you are.

This means welcoming and affirming people of every gender identity and expression, sexual orientation, age, race, ethnicity, physical and mental ability, level of education, family structure, economic, immigration, material, and social status—and so much more.

This welcome includes those who struggle with our commitment to offering full participation to all who have been hurt when we’ve failed, and calls each of us to graciously live together in the community of Christ regardless of our differences.

As followers of Jesus, we commit ourselves to the pursuit of justice while standing in solidarity with all who are marginalized and oppressed.

Adopted September 2023.
